A test of a driver's perception reaction time is being conducted on a special testing track with wet pavement and a driving speed of 55 mi/hr. When the driver is sober, a stop can be made just in time to avoid hitting an object that is first visible 520 ft ahead. After a few drinks under exactly the same conditions, the driver fails to stop in time and strikes the object at a speed of 35 mi/hr. Determine the driver's perception/reaction time before and after drinking.
